Ansatzfrage: HTML Datei auslesen ...

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Ansatzfrage: HTML Datei auslesen ...

    Hallo,
    ich habe eine Ansatzfrage. Ich möchte von einer anderen Homepage Fussballtabellen auslesen. Leider liegt die Seite nicht als RSS/XML vor.

    Der Betreiber hat mir ausdrücklich erlaubt die Seite (falls es mir gelingen sollte) auszulesen. Der Betreiber selber will sich aber keine mühe machen bzw. hat mir im Email Schriftverkehr zu verstehen gegeben das es ihn überhaupt nicht interssiert solange man nicht versucht die Inhalte zu ändern und keine Copyrights entfernt/verletzt.

    Hätte jemand ein Beispiel bzw. Ansatz wie ich eine fremde Seite am besten auslese....

    mfg
    bugbuster

    ps: der link fussballtabelle
    Zuletzt geändert von Bugbuster; 16.04.2008, 04:04.
    tutorial: peterkropff.de schattenbaum.de tut.php-quake.net
    documentation: php.net mysql.com framework.zend.com

    Die Nachtwache!

  • #2
    Mittels fopen einlesen.

    Kommentar


    • #3
      Äh include() ??

      Ansonsten mit fopen()

      PHP-Code:
      $page=fopen("http://fussball.sport1.de/dbc/34/05-06/13/54/22/verein/mannschaft/139/prttab","r");

      while(!
      feof($page)) {
       
      $content .= fread($page,4096);
      }
      fclose($wp); 
      Somit hast du unter $content die ganze Seite. Da kannst du nun die body, header etc. Tags wegschneiden und hast nur noch die Tabelle.

      EDIT:

      Zu langsam

      gruss Chris

      [color=blue]Derjenige, der sagt: "Es geht nicht", soll den nicht stoeren, der's gerade tut."[/color]

      Kommentar


      • #4
        ja ihr habt scho recht ... ich wollte die seite aufbereiten und die tabellen bereitstellen per xml deshalb evtl nen bissel kompilierter? schonma danke ^^
        tutorial: peterkropff.de schattenbaum.de tut.php-quake.net
        documentation: php.net mysql.com framework.zend.com

        Die Nachtwache!

        Kommentar


        • #5
          nimm lieber file_get_contents(), das aber nur am rande ...

          lies den inhalt der datei aus und mittels regulärer ausdrücke, preg_match_all() z.b., kannst du extrahieren ... ist nicht schwör.
          Die Zeit hat ihre Kinder längst gefressen

          Kommentar


          • #6
            oki danke ich probiers dann morgen früh gleich ma aus
            tutorial: peterkropff.de schattenbaum.de tut.php-quake.net
            documentation: php.net mysql.com framework.zend.com

            Die Nachtwache!

            Kommentar

            Lädt...
            X